    @voodoo Yeah, there have been several reports in - particularly South African - media of doping in SA schoolboy rugby, the last few years. I've read a few of them. It's worrying, not just for the sport in SA, but also from a health perspective.

    I've watched some of the games of the World Schools Festival for the last two years and some of these players were indeed HUGE compared to many of our players, which could not just be explained by a higher average age. It made me wonder ...
    (Btw, the next edition of the WSF is from 24 to 28 March 2020; King's College will be one of the participating schools).

    Not sure whether it's happening across all schools, or whether it's mostly at specific, individual schools. I also don't know how common it is; don't remember seeing numbers.
